Step 1
Add cranberries to a food processor and pulse to finely chop the berries.
Step 2
Add sugar to the cranberries and pulse until mixed. Transfer cranberries to a bowl.
Step 3
Cover the bowl with plastic wrap and refrigerate overnight (or at least 2 hours).
Step 4
Add the crushed pineapple, grapes, and pecans to the cranberries and mix it all together.
Step 5
Add the mini marshmallows and mix. Add the Cool Whip and fold everything together until thoroughly mixed.
Step 6
Serve immediately or cover and store in the refrigerator. I like to top this salad with some cranberries, grapes, pecans, and marshmallows for garnish. If you're going to do this, set a little of each aside before starting the recipe.
